In today’s world, petroleum resource is shortage, after first mining and second mining, there still have more than half of the oil remains underground, so it must starts third time to improve the recovery of oil drilling, but at the moment, useing a conventional method can not mining or mining inefficiency, we must use more complex technology means than water injection and note gas to recovery. At present, three mining has many methods, for example, asp flooding, polymer flooding, foam flooding, etc. As the saying goes:If you have no hand you can’t make a fist, although there have three times of the theory and method of mining, we but must have a set of experimental apparatus to make these methods be put into practice. The core displacement is for instrument eor combining theory with practice product, which according to drive mechanism and principle for similar simulation of geological strata temperature and pressure conditions, with the aid of computer, sensor technology, the simulation oil displacement system in porous media seepage characteristics, such as oil displacement efficiency, it can then in simulating various stratum condition assessment oil displacement effect.This topic according to the experiment tertiary oil recovery mechanism, developed a set of research can be flooding seepage characteristics and the oil displacement effect of instrument (the core displacement for instrument), from the hardware system and PC control system two aspects of the core displacement is for the function module part of the working principle, design process of the system analyzed in detail. The design of the hardware system mainly includes: power supply system, injection flooding, ring crush for system tracking system, the oven temperature system and differential pressure monitoring system several aspects, gives each link solutions, including design ideas, circuit principle, components of choice and so on; The computer measurement and control system of the company is based on the NI LabWindows/Cvi measurement and control software development formed, used to realize human-machine interaction, the main finish the experiment data acquisition and processing, the process control such tasks, greatly enhancing the automation degree of the instrument, provide the perfect for experimental data services.
